About Augsburg

Augsburg are a football club from Germany, tracked in Bundesliga alongside 17 other clubs on MyLineups for the 2025/2026 season.

In the most recent lineup on record, Augsburg line up in a 3-4-2-1, with a back 3, Dahmen in goal, and Gouweleeuw wearing the armband.

The 28-man squad spans 15 nationalities, led by Germany (8 players). The starting XI averages 27.3 years and carries a combined value of roughly 82.7 million.

In goal: Dahmen (Germany), Klein (Germany), and Labrovic (Croatia).

In defence: Gouweleeuw (Netherlands), Matsima (France), Zesiger (Switzerland), Banks (United States), Chaves (Brazil), Meiser (Germany), Schlotterbeck (Germany), and Sorg (Austria).

In midfield: Fellhauer (Germany), Kade (Germany), Keitel (Germany), Kömür (Türkiye), Rieder (Switzerland), Wolf (Germany), Claude-Maurice (France), Gharbi (Tunisia), Giannoulis (GR), Jakic (Croatia), Kücüksahin (Türkiye), Massengo (France), Pedersen (Denmark), and Rexhbeçaj (XK).

In attack: Gregoritsch (Austria), Ogundu (NG), and Ribeiro (Portugal).

Manuel Baum (GER) is the head coach behind this setup.
